Free Infrared Thermography

Our home inspectors use infrared thermography on every project. By scanning for heat variations within the house, we can look for issues hiding behind walls and ceilings without having to open up walls.

Thermography lets us “see” heat variations that can be a sign of:

  • Roof leaks
  • Water damage
  • Pest infestations
  • Electrical problems

Air Quality Testing

Our indoor air quality testing determines whether your home contains particularly dangerous bacteria, mold spores, and fungus. Knowing about these issues gives you the opportunity to treat them prior to moving into the home so you aren’t putting your health at risk.

Water Quality Testing

Well users and homeowners who have experienced line breaks should undergo water quality testing. Our accurate test looks for bacteria, heavy metals, chemicals, and pH variations so you know your water is safe to drink and use.
